- The distance between Hua Hin, Thailand and Tauranga, New Zealand is approximately 9,685 km or 6,018 mi.
- To reach Hua Hin in this distance one would set out from Tauranga bearing 288.3°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Hua Hin bearing 309.7° or NW .
- Hua Hin has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Tauranga has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Hua Hin is in or near the tropical moist forest biome whereas Tauranga is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The average annual temperature is 13.1 °C (23.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.5 °C (9.9°F) less in Hua Hin.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 293.9 mm (11.6 in) less which is equivalent to 293.9 l/m² (7.21 US gal/ft²) or 2,939,000 l/ha (314,199 US gal/ac) less. About 7/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.1° higher in Hua Hin than in Tauranga.
